In our ongoing efforts to support STEM education in South Africa, we recently hosted Chelsey Roebuck, co-founder and executive director of Elite Education, to present a series of digital literacy and coding workshops to learners in Ga-Rankuwa and Mamelodi.
Skills students gained ranged from emailing and web research do's and don'ts to HTML coding.
Roebuck presented these workshops to learners from the LEAP Science School in Ga-Rankuwa and to the students from our Mae Jemison U.S. Science Reading Room in Mamelodi. Cultural affairs assistant Ruth Koko thanked Roebuck for presenting the workshops.
